(or circulating capital.) The capital which is consumed at each operation of production and reappeurs transformed into new pruducts. Ateach sale of these products the capital is represented in cash, and itis from its transformations that profit is derived. Floating capital includes raw materials destined for fabrication, such as wool and flax, products in the warehouses of manufacturers or merchants, such as cloth and linen, and money for wages, and stores. De Laveleye, Pol. Ec. Capital retained for the purpose of meeting current expenditure.
